The growing demand for sustainable and cruelty-free alternatives to conventional leather has led to the emergence of the Biobased Leather Market. With increasing environmental concerns and ethical considerations, industries such as fashion, automotive, and furniture are shifting towards eco-friendly materials. Biobased leather, derived from plant-based and renewable sources, presents a promising solution to the environmental challenges associated with traditional leather production.

Market Overview

The biobased leather market is experiencing rapid growth, driven by advancements in material science and consumer preference for sustainable products. Unlike synthetic leather, which often contains petroleum-based plastics, biobased leather is produced using mushrooms, apple peels, cactus, pineapple leaves, and other plant-derived fibers. These materials offer durability and aesthetic appeal comparable to traditional leather, while significantly reducing carbon emissions and water consumption.

Key Drivers of Growth

  1. Rising Environmental Awareness
  2. Consumers and brands are becoming more conscious of the environmental impact of leather production. Traditional leather tanning involves harmful chemicals such as chromium and generates high carbon emissions. Biobased leather offers a lower environmental footprint, making it a preferred alternative.
  3. Stringent Government Regulations
  4. Governments and regulatory bodies worldwide are promoting sustainable materials and imposing restrictions on environmentally harmful practices. Bans on certain tanning chemicals and incentives for eco-friendly materials are boosting the adoption of biobased leather.
  5. Ethical and Cruelty-Free Consumer Trends
  6. The global movement towards vegan and cruelty-free products is driving demand for biobased leather. Many consumers, particularly in the fashion and luxury industries, seek alternatives that align with their ethical values.
  7. Technological Innovations
  8. Advancements in bioengineering and material processing are enhancing the quality, texture, and durability of biobased leather. Companies are investing in R&D to develop materials that mimic the properties of animal leather while being biodegradable and sustainable.

Challenges and Restraints

Despite its promising future, the biobased leather market faces several challenges:

  • High Production Costs: Biobased leather manufacturing is still in its early stages, making it more expensive than synthetic or traditional leather.
  • Limited Scalability: Large-scale production remains a challenge due to limited raw material availability and processing complexities.
  • Performance and Durability Concerns: While biobased leather has improved significantly, some products may not yet match the durability of traditional leather.

Market Segmentation

The biobased leather market can be segmented based on:

  • Source Material: Mushroom-based (mycelium), plant-based (pineapple, apple, cactus), and lab-grown alternatives.
  • End-Use Industry: Fashion, automotive, furniture, and accessories.
  • Region: North America, Europe, Asia-Pacific, Latin America, and the Middle East & Africa.
